The Allure of Boarding Schools
Boarding schools have long been synonymous with academic rigor, holistic development, and a close-knit community. These institutions offer a unique educational experience that extends beyond the traditional classroom setting. Students live, learn, and grow together, fostering a strong sense of camaraderie and lifelong friendships. Boarding schools are known for their small class sizes, dedicated faculty, and personalized attention. This allows teachers to cater to the individual needs of each student, providing tailored support and encouragement. The residential environment also promotes independence, responsibility, and self-reliance. Students learn to manage their time, take care of their belongings, and resolve conflicts independently.
One of the key advantages of boarding schools is their diverse range of extracurricular activities. In addition to OSports, boarding schools offer a wide array of clubs, organizations, and artistic pursuits. Students can participate in drama, music, debate, student government, and community service projects. This allows them to explore their interests, develop their talents, and broaden their horizons. Boarding schools also provide opportunities for leadership development. Students can serve as prefects, club officers, or team captains, gaining valuable experience in leadership and teamwork. These experiences prepare them for leadership roles in college and their future careers.
Another significant benefit of boarding schools is their emphasis on character development. Boarding schools instill values such as integrity, respect, responsibility, and compassion. Students are expected to uphold high ethical standards and treat others with kindness and consideration. The residential environment provides opportunities for students to learn from their mistakes and develop a strong moral compass. Boarding schools also promote cultural awareness and global citizenship. Students come from diverse backgrounds and nationalities, creating a multicultural environment that fosters understanding and respect. This prepares students to be responsible and engaged citizens of the world.
Boarding schools are a popular choice for families seeking a challenging and supportive educational environment for their children. They offer a unique blend of academics, athletics, and extracurricular activities that prepares students for success in college and beyond. The residential environment fosters independence, responsibility, and character development, while the close-knit community provides a sense of belonging and lifelong friendships.
